
一、界面设计优化
1. 简化布局:通过减少页面上的元素数量,使书签栏更加简洁明了。例如,可以采用扁平化的设计,避免过多的装饰性元素,让用户能够更快地找到他们需要的书签。
2. 个性化定制:允许用户根据自己的喜好调整书签栏的外观和布局。例如,用户可以自定义书签栏的颜色、图标样式等,使其更加符合个人的审美和使用习惯。
3. 响应式设计:确保书签栏在不同设备和屏幕尺寸下都能保持良好的显示效果。例如,可以采用自适应的设计,根据屏幕大小自动调整书签栏的宽度和高度,确保用户在不同设备上都能获得良好的使用体验。
二、搜索功能增强
1. 智能推荐:根据用户的浏览历史和行为模式,智能推荐相关的书签。例如,当用户经常访问某个主题的网站时,系统可以推荐更多相关的内容,帮助用户更深入地了解该主题。
2. 快速搜索:提供强大的搜索功能,让用户能够快速找到所需的书签。例如,可以通过关键词搜索、分类筛选等方式,帮助用户快速定位到所需的书签。
3. 语音搜索:集成语音识别技术,支持用户通过语音命令搜索书签。例如,用户可以说出“搜索关于天气的书签”,系统会自动识别并给出相关结果。
三、数据同步与备份
1. 跨设备同步:实现书签的跨设备同步功能,让用户在不同设备之间无缝切换。例如,用户可以在一台设备上添加一个书签,然后在另一台设备上查看或编辑该书签。
2. 定期备份:定期将书签数据备份到云端或本地存储,防止数据丢失。例如,用户可以设置定期自动备份书签数据,并在需要时恢复备份。
3. 加密保护:对敏感数据进行加密处理,确保数据的安全性。例如,可以使用SSL加密传输书签数据,防止数据在传输过程中被窃取或篡改。
四、性能优化
1. 加速加载:优化书签数据的加载速度,提高用户体验。例如,可以采用缓存技术、压缩算法等方式,减少书签数据的传输量和加载时间。
2. 减少内存占用:优化书签数据的存储方式,降低内存占用。例如,可以采用轻量级的数据结构、压缩算法等方式,减少书签数据的体积和内存占用。
3. 优化渲染流程:优化书签数据的渲染流程,提高渲染效率。例如,可以采用预渲染、懒加载等方式,减少渲染过程中的等待时间和资源消耗。
五、安全性提升
1. 防止恶意软件:确保书签数据的安全性,防止恶意软件的侵入。例如,可以采用加密技术、数字签名等方式,确保书签数据的真实性和完整性。
2. 防止数据泄露:加强数据加密措施,防止数据泄露。例如,可以采用对称加密、非对称加密等方式,确保数据在传输和存储过程中的安全性。
3. 防止网络攻击:加强网络安全防护,防止网络攻击导致的数据泄露。例如,可以采用防火墙、入侵检测系统等方式,及时发现和应对网络攻击行为。
六、用户体验改进
1. 快速访问:优化书签的查找和访问速度,提高用户体验。例如,可以采用高效的数据索引、智能排序等功能,帮助用户快速定位到所需的书签。
2. 易用性:简化操作流程,降低使用门槛。例如,可以提供一键添加、删除书签的功能,以及直观的界面提示和帮助文档,帮助用户快速上手。
3. 反馈机制:建立有效的反馈渠道,及时收集用户意见和建议。例如,可以设置在线客服、反馈表单等方式,鼓励用户提出问题和建议,以便不断改进产品。
综上所述,通过对Chrome浏览器书签管理功能的优化研究,我们可以发现其存在诸多不足之处。为了提升用户体验和满足用户需求,我们需要从多个方面入手进行改进。